Prestige Estates notes that while there is some inventory buildup in the luxury housing segment, particularly in the above-Rs 4 crore category, the overall demand remains robust. They have sold over 1,100 out of 2,000 apartments launched in the Rs 4 crore-Rs 6 crore category in Bengaluru in the past five months.
Prestige Estates believes that the mid-income and premium segments, priced between Rs 1.5 crore and Rs 4 crore, are underserved in key markets. They see a significant demand-supply gap in these segments.
Prestige Estates is planning to launch its integrated township format, the Prestige City project, in Ghaziabad's Indirapuram. The project is on a 62.5-acre land parcel with a gross development potential of around Rs 11,000 crore. They are also exploring more regions in NCR, including Gurugram and more land parcels in Noida.
Prestige Estates is planning to deliver its first two projects in Mumbai—the Prestige Jasdan Classic in Mahalaxmi and the Prestige Siesta project in Mulund. They are also proceeding with the ultra-luxury Prestige Nautilius project in Worli, targeting an average ticket size of up to Rs 50 crore.
Despite raising around Rs 5,000 crore from a qualified institutional placement (QIP), Prestige Estates is largely funding its new projects, including the Indirapuram project and recent launches in Bengaluru, through internal accruals. The QIP proceeds are being used to retire debt and acquire land in target geographies.
